Readyboost type technologies simply cache harddrive accesses in flash memory.
While flash memory is lower latency than accessing a harddrive, you can't compare it to a ram upgrade - the two are addressing almost entirely different needs.
Note. I'm not disputing that ready boost will improve performance; but it should be considered an addition, not an alternative, to adding more memory.0 -
